It can happen either way if you're overdue, but you're not overdue until 40+ weeks, I've never heard of a doctor, ever, suggesting castor oil. And there are a LOT of women that take castor oil and their baby has their first BM in the womb, which can result in a lung infection and time in the NICU. A woman not too long ago on here went through this. Even if there's a 1% risk of it, why risk it? There's no proven study because no one wants to use their baby as a guinea pig. Castor oil can cause you to become dehydrated. In some women it causes extreme diarrhea and vomiting. It can also cause baby to have their first bowel movement in utero and meconiun aspiration is potentially life threatening. So, in my opinion, it's not safe.
